Does the photovoltaic bracket need CE certification
In Europe, the CE (Conformité Européene) certification is a must - have for solar panels brackets kits. The CE mark indicates that the product complies with all relevant European health, safety, and environmental protection legislation. UL 2703 is the specific standard for photovoltaic (PV) mounting systems. This standard covers aspects like structural integrity, corrosion resistance, and electrical. . Meeting standards and certification requirements is crucial for manufacturers for several reasons. Certifications are badges of quality that demonstrate a manufacturer's commitment to producing high-quality products.

Photovoltaic brackets are supports used in photovoltaic systems to tilt and fix the solar panels in a desired position so as to enable optimum solar energy collection and absorption. They carry solar panels, ensuring that they are stably installed on the roof or on the ground, maximizing the absorption of solar energy and converting it into renewable energy.
